The 2015 biographical drama Steve Jobs , directed by Danny Boyle and written by Aaron Sorkin, remains a masterclass in modern filmmaking. Shifting away from the traditional birth-to-death biopic structure, the film unfolds in three high-tension acts, each taking place backstage just before a major product launch. Michael Fassbender delivers a fierce, uncompromising performance as Jobs, capturing his obsessive perfectionism and magnetic intensity. He is backed by an incredible supporting cast, including Kate Winslet as Joanna Hoffman, Seth Rogen as Steve Wozniak, and Jeff Daniels as John Sculley. 1080p Blu-Ray Visual Perfection
